    Zenos's Art of the Sword

    Just HOW is one supposed to dodge this stupidly cheap attack?

    It seems that the graphics on the floor come out of the little orbs that float around him, but said orbs move faster than you could even with sprint, so there's no way to stay out of line of sight from the orbs.

    Seems like no matter where you are, you're going to get hit no matter what, and usually the hits are 9k or so.... but sometimes he decides to just randomly plow you 3-4 times and insta-kill you *snap* just like that and there's nothing you can even DO about it, or at least it looks that way.

    As many times as I've fought the guy I've tried to come up with some method of dealing with this cheap attack, but it just doesn't look like there's anything outside of RNG that you can really do about it, unless there's some sort of vague cue that I'm missing?

    Like people said its a line AoE targeted on all party members. Ideally you want each member on a different facing. During the swords phase I find it usually works best to leave the sword belonging to that ability for last since party split on the other 2 will usually take care of making sure the beams don't stack.

    Just a quick update to this since most DF groups and guides, as well as the previous responses all claim to just spread and that it can't be dodged.

    It can be dodged, I dodge it all the time.

    People are correct that you need to spread to avoid potentially hitting other players with it however by strafing/sidestepping right at the end of the cast you will avoid being hit. There is a slight delay from when the server determines your position for where to shoot out the line AoE and when the AoE goes out (we are talking like half a second or so here), so if you are moving to the side as this is happening you will have moved out of where the AoE registered you were and dodge it. Keep in mind it is a pretty wide line AoE and the window is small so you have to be a little on your toes and be extra careful to not sidestep into your other party members.

    Bonus tip, shields like TBN prevent the knockback effect from Art of the Swell as long as all the damage from the attack gets absorbed since technically only the shield gets hit by the attack and not you. Pretty sure I have used TBN to avoid the knockback from Vacuum Wave too.
